About Lana Sabelfeld

Lana is a senior lecturer and tenured associate professor in business administration. Her research interests revolve around topics such as accounting, sustainability, regulation, and communication. She explores practices of sustainability accounting and integrated reporting in different economic, cultural, and regulatory contexts (for ex. in Sweden and Japan). Lana´s research received Oscar Sillén Prize (2014), Emerald Literati Award for Highly Commended article (2019), and Emerald Literati Award for Outstanding article (2021). She also serves as a member of the Editorial Advisory Board for Accounting, Auditing and Accountability Journal, and is a member of Handelshögskolan´s Executive Faculty program, exchanging experience and knowledge with the Swedish industries.
